Witch Hat Atelier Is Redefining Magic Anime, and One Detail Proves It’s the Genre’s Best Ever

Witch Hat Atelier offers a fresh take on fantasy by showing that magic isn’t about special powers, but a skill anyone can learn. It’s not a mystical gift, but something based on logic, science, and math. Witches have to study and understand the fundamentals – the ‘rules’ of magic – and then use that knowledge to create spells for any situation. This makes magic feel less like a mysterious force and more like a craft that requires dedication, study, and problem-solving – skills we all use in our daily lives.

The Elder Scrolls 6 Report Gives New Update on Long-Awaited Bethesda Game

A new report aligns with previous predictions that The Elder Scrolls 6 will likely release between 2028 and 2029. This report also indicates the game won’t be revealed at the Xbox Games Showcase this Sunday, June 7th. This suggests a 2026 release is unlikely, as any announcement would likely happen at this event. Xbox probably wants to control the timing of the reveal and won’t share the spotlight with anyone else, or announce it on an ordinary day. The Game Awards later this year is a possible exception. Most likely, we’ll see the game again at the Xbox summer showcase next year, or perhaps not until 2028. If the release isn’t until 2029, Bethesda’s history suggests we might not even hear about it again until then, as they often prefer brief, focused marketing campaigns.
